2.3 Intelligent Ambient Climate Control
The 4000’s “Ambient” system is an active guardian of product quality and margin.
-
Dynamic Climate Management: A thermostat-controlled, forced-air circulation system maintains a precise internal temperature between 68°F and 74°F (20°C – 23°C). It automatically activates cooling or mild heating to counteract external environmental swings.
-
Humidity & Condensation Mitigation: The system manages air flow to prevent moisture buildup, which is critical for preserving the texture of baked goods, crackers, and chips, directly reducing waste and customer dissatisfaction.
-
Energy-Adaptive Operation: The system includes eco-modes that reduce fan speed during prolonged idle periods (e.g., overnight in an office), cutting energy costs without compromising the protective environment.

3.3 Precision Delivery & Customer Experience Assurance
-
High-Reliacy Vending: Durable, geared spiral motors provide consistent torque. An optical “last-product” sensor at the front of each spiral provides accurate sold-out data to the inventory system.
-
Soft-Drop Delivery Channel: Products are guided down a smooth, low-friction chute into a large, well-lit delivery bin. A clear, polycarbonate security door unlocks only upon successful vend verification.
-
100% Vend Assurance: An infrared sensor in the delivery bin confirms product landing before the transaction is finalized. This eliminates “I lost my money” customer service issues and ensures perfect inventory accuracy.

6.3 Proactive Health Monitoring & Alerts
-
Machine Vital Signs: Monitor compressor cycles (in coolers), motor current draw, sensor health, and network signal strength.
-
Predictive Maintenance Alerts: The system can flag a motor drawing increasing amperage—a sign of impending failure—allowing a technician to replace it during a routine restock visit, preventing an emergency call.
-
Diagnostic Trouble Codes: Detailed error codes are transmitted to the cloud, giving technicians a head start on diagnosis before they even dispatch.

8.2 Predictive Diagnostics & Maximized Uptime
-
From Reactive to Proactive: The connected health data shifts the service model. Instead of “machine is down,” the alert is “motor C4 is showing early signs of wear—schedule replacement on next visit.”
-
>99% Uptime Achievement: This proactive approach, combined with rapid modular repair, ensures the machine is almost always generating revenue.
-
Optimized Service Routes: Technicians are dispatched with purpose: a truck full of pre-kitted products for restocking visits, and with the exact part needed for a repair visit. This eliminates wasted trips.
